The Role
Unite Students fantastic Accounts Payable team have an exciting opportunity for a Senior Accounts Payable Assistant to join us in our Bristol office.
In this role you will provide an efficient and customer focused payables service, ensuring effective purchasing processes and compliance are in place.
You will ensure both internal and external customer needs are met whilst adhering to specified SLAs and enabling suppliers to be paid as per agreed terms.

As the Senior within the team, the role will include line management responsibilities, supporting with mentoring the less experienced members of the team, supporting in ensuring processes are adhered to and documented and being a support for escalation within the Team as well as covering times of absence for the Supervisor.
What You`ll Be Doing
* As the Senior within the team, the role will include supporting the team with 1-2-1`s, PDPs, appraisals, and any other line management support
* Support any business training activities in the payables area as required, as well as ensuring documentation in maintained and up to date
* Build and maintain relationships with suppliers and internal stakeholders to enable swift and accurate processing of invoices and timely settlement. Educate on the result/consequence of non-compliance e.g. No PO, No Pay. Escalate where necessary
* Serve as a subject matter expert (SME) for projects, offering expertise and guidance to support successful project delivery
* Take a positive approach to change within the business, generating and implementing ideas for continuous process improvement within Financial Services. To work with the Procurement and other stake holders highlighting areas which require improvement and collectively working towards resolution
* Support with any audit queries as required
* Ensuring all procedure documentation is kept up to date
* Close off the month end AP ledger
* Monthly reconciliation of priority/business critical suppliers including any legal letters, and ensure timely resolution of any queries/outstanding balances
* Overseeing our council tax and business rates processes, while building and maintaining relationships with local authorities to ensure compliance and efficiency
* Oversee the administration of our company fleet, ensuring compliance and operational effectiveness
* Manage company credit card administration, ensuring compliance and accuracy in the compliance of financial transactions
* Coordinate user accounts for travel and accommodation, streamlining processes for efficiency and cost-effectiveness
* Bank systems Admin
What We`re Looking for in You
* Strong experience in an accounts payable role
* Excellent communication, skills both verbal and written.
* Ability to work at a fast pace with a high level of accuracy.
* Comfortable working within a changing environment, managing priorities effectively.
* Pro-active and able to work on own initiative.
* Experience working effectively as part of a team.
* A self-starter who can demonstrate initiative, with the ability to prioritise workloads of self and team members
* Strong attention to detail
* Provide management information to support functional and business decisions
* Experience of working with Oracle and Bottomline Webflo invoice workflow
* Experience working in a customer focused environment and dealing with a variety of different stakeholders.
* Experience of producing complex supplier reconciliations in excel.
